Capillary Electrophoresis (CE) is a biotechnological technique used to separate and analyze molecules based on their size, charge, and shape. It is a powerful tool for analyzing proteins, peptides, nucleic acids, and other biomolecules. CE is used in a variety of applications, including drug discovery, clinical diagnostics, and forensic analysis.
CE is a high-resolution technique that offers several advantages over traditional electrophoresis methods. It is faster, more efficient, and requires less sample preparation. Additionally, it is highly sensitive and can detect even trace amounts of molecules.
